#fa85e8 - Lavender Rose Hex Color Code

#FA85E8 (Lavender Rose) - RGB 250, 133, 232 Color Information

#fa85e8 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et FA, 85, E8
RGB Decimal 250, 133, 232
RGB Octal 372, 205, 350
RGB Percent 98%, 52.2%, 91%
RGB Binary 11111010, 10000101, 11101000
CMY 0.020, 0.478, 0.090
CMYK 0, 47, 7, 2

Color spaces of #FA85E8 Lavender Rose - RGB(250, 133, 232)

HSV (or HSB) 309°, 47°, 98°
HSL 309°, 92°, 75°
Web Safe #ff99ff
XYZ 62.377, 42.925, 81.342
CIE-Lab 71.504, 57.336, -30.605
xyY 0.334, 0.230, 42.925
Decimal 16418280

#fa85e8 - RGB(250, 133, 232) - Lavender Rose Color FAQ

What is the color code for Lavender Rose?

Hex color code for Lavender Rose color is #fa85e8. RGB color code for lavender rose color is rgb(250, 133, 232).

What is the RGB value of #fa85e8?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#fa85e8 is rgb(250, 133, 232).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'250' indicates the intensity of the red component, '133' represents the green component's intensity, and '232'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#fa85e8.
